ETME 32803 - (was 3328) Computer Aided Manufacturing (CAM)


Two hours lecture. Three hours laboratory per week. Three credit hours.

Was ETME 3328. A study of the programming standards used in industry to control NC and CNC equipment. G and M codes, and specific control commands used in manual programs. Computer-aided design and manufacturing software to generate part geometry and tool path information. Preparation of the final program used by the CNC controllers to machine the designed parts.

Prerequisites: Grades of C or greater in ETME 20303 , ETME 23303 , and ETME 21703 .
